I just put in some ED 6.5's and I have them running on an amp at 75rms. If I have the bass freq. blocked off at whatever HZ, should I worry about the highs as well? Will highs through the speaker matter? If so, how do I block them out? Also, would I be better off using the amps crossover or the headunits? I have a clarion 935 dvd player.

Thanks

 
should I worry about the highs as well? Will highs through the speaker matter? If so, how do I block them out?
No, in a component set with a passive crossover the only thing you need to do is use a highpass filter.

Also, would I be better off using the amps crossover or the headunits?
Try both. See which one you like better. Heck, try using them together and see if you like the results.

 
I see. In that case, you will likely want to lowpass the mid aswell. I would use the highpass filter on the HU, and the lowpass filter on the amplifier to bandpass the mid.
